[this thread is regarding sata_inic162x, misplaced reply]

Bob Stewart wrote:
> There is still something else bad going on in your driver.  I've tried
> everything I can think of (timing changes, flushes, and whatnot)
> but I still get random timeouts and random results from md5sum
> on large files.  Even in the case where I don't get a timeout on a large
> iso file, the md5sum is still random.  Strangely enough, though, 
> the files may be good on-disk, since totem seems to play the DVD.iso
> that I'm testing with without a problem.  I'm using debian with a 2.6.19.2
> kernel.

Yeap, I'm aware of the problem.  That's why the driver is marked HIGHLY
EXPERIMENTAL.  Maybe I should change it to broken.  :-(  Anyways, one of
the known problems is mishandling of LBA48 commands which is cause of
timeouts and wrong md5sums on large disks.  I just couldn't find any
time to work on it in recent weeks.  Please be patient a bit.  I'll get
back to sata_ini162x in a few days.
